Sound Quality

Performance begins with the hardware. Sound quality in wireless headphones largely depends on driver size, with 40mm drivers commonly offering stronger bass and clearer audio. Larger drivers enhance soundstage and detail reproduction, contributing to overall fidelity. High-resolution audio support, particularly Hi-Res certification, allows playback of finely detailed audio across extended frequency ranges, improving listening precision. Active noise cancellation plays a key role by minimizing ambient distractions, enabling clearer perception of audio dynamics. Sensitivity ratings, measured in decibels, influence output volume; higher sensitivity delivers louder, distortion-free sound at lower power. Customizable equalizer settings let users adjust audio profiles to suit genres or preferences, refining tonal balance. Together, these factors determine the clarity, depth, and accuracy of sound, making them essential considerations for evaluating the acoustic performance of wireless headphones in 2026.

Noise Cancellation

Long battery life guarantees uninterrupted listening, but the quality of that experience often hinges on a headphone’s ability to isolate sound. Active Noise Cancelling (ANC) technology can reduce external noise by up to 90%, delivering immersive audio even in loud environments. Hybrid ANC systems use multiple microphones to dynamically counter ambient noise, enhancing suppression across varied settings. Over-ear designs generally provide superior sound isolation compared to on-ear or in-ear models, making them ideal for effective noise cancellation. Some models include ambient awareness modes, allowing users to remain aware of surroundings while listening, improving safety outdoors. ANC also improves call quality by filtering background noise through dedicated microphones, ensuring clearer voice transmission. Buyers should evaluate the type and adaptability of ANC systems, as performance varies greatly between models and use cases. Effective noise cancellation enhances both audio fidelity and communication reliability.

Connectivity Options

To guarantee a seamless listening experience, users should evaluate the connectivity features of wireless headphones carefully. Bluetooth 5.0 or higher guarantees stable connections with extended range, often up to 10 meters. Multipoint pairing allows simultaneous connection to two devices, beneficial for multitasking between phones, tablets, or laptops. Compatibility with voice assistants like Amazon Alexa, Google Assistant, or Siri enables hands-free control. Headphones with USB Type-C ports support faster charging and broader device compatibility, while a 3.5mm audio jack offers wired playback options. Features such as Google Fast Pair or Microsoft Swift Pair simplify initial and subsequent pairings with compatible devices. These connectivity options collectively enhance convenience, interoperability, and long-term usability across diverse ecosystems, allowing users to maintain consistent access to audio without interruption or complicated setup procedures.
